Senti-Watcher

Villanova Computer Science Senior Project by Ava, Jason, and Justin

Senti-Watcher Logo

Background

Studies suggest that stock prices rise with positive sentiment and fall with negative sentiment, so we created Senti-Watcher: An application that allows users to choose a ticker and time period and view the correlation between the media sentiment of a publicly traded company and equity price movement. Knowing the sentiment expressed about a company creates informed decision-making in investing and increased awareness of market factors.

Installation

After pip and python have been installed:

  • pip install Flask
  • pip install requests
  • pip install jsonify
  • pip install responses
  • pip install textblob
  • pip install regex
  • pip install logging
  • pip install DateTime
  • pip install Flask-Cors
  • pip install boto3

After node.js has been installed:

  • npm install
  • npm i rebass
  • npm i @rebass/preset emotion-theming
  • npm install react-bootstrap bootstrap

Run

In ~/sp-jason-ava-justin directory:

  • python3 run.py In ~/sp-jason-ava-justin/reactapp/sentiment-analysis-frontend directory:
  • npm start
